Multicultural Heritage

Malaysia’s population is a rich mix of Malay, Chinese, Indian, and Indigenous cultures, each contributing to the country’s festivals, food, architecture, and traditions. Visit the colorful temples of Little India, explore the historic streets of George Town in Penang, and witness the blend of mosques, churches, and shrines that dot every city.

Nature & Wildlife Encounters

Borneo’s jungles are some of the oldest on Earth. Here, you can trek through the Danum Valley, spot orangutans in Sepilok, and cruise along the Kinabatangan River in search of proboscis monkeys and pygmy elephants. For cooler climates, escape to the Cameron Highlands, where rolling tea plantations and misty forests await.

Tropical Island Paradise

Malaysia’s coastlines are lined with stunning islands. Relax on the beaches of Langkawi, snorkel coral reefs in the Perhentian Islands, or dive in Sipadan, one of the world’s top diving spots. With crystal-clear waters and laid-back vibes, island life is never far away.

When is the best time to visit Malaysia?

Malaysia is a year-round destination, but the best time depends on where you're going.
West Coast (Penang, Langkawi, Kuala Lumpur): Best between December and April, with sunny weather and lower rainfall.
East Coast (Perhentian Islands, Tioman): Best between March and September, as monsoon season hits from November to February.
Borneo (Sabah, Sarawak): Great all year, though March to October is typically drier.
